  • Publication number: 20170108131
    Abstract: A check valve is provided which may be installed horizontally or in other non-vertical orientations, and used with variable frequency drives and other applications without the valve becoming misaligned. In one aspect, the valve includes a housing with an inner surface and a passage. A flange within the housing divides the housing into upstream and downstream portions, and extends around the inner surface, defining a valve seat and a valve aperture. A poppet is positioned in the downstream portion. The poppet includes a valve head and a plurality of guide legs extending from the valve head and into the downstream portion, and not through the valve aperture. The valve head is resiliently biased in the closed position against the valve seat to inhibit fluid flow in a first direction. A guide disposed within the housing receives the plurality of guide legs of the poppet valve as the poppet valve moves between an open position and a closed position.

  • Publication number: 20170108165
    Abstract: A self-sealing mounting bracket includes an outer shell that defines at least one downwardly facing chamber. A plunger is located in the downwardly facing chamber and is slidable within the chamber. The chamber is filled with sealant either at the manufacturing facility or in the field. Larger openings are formed in the top of the outer shell that align with and provide access to bolt holes in the top of the plunger. Smaller openings in the top of the outer shell are for attaching the shell to a roof with lag bolts. The mounting bracket is located on a shingled roof and lag bolts are inserted through the larger openings and threaded into the roof deck. The heads of these lag bolts pass through the larger openings and engage the plungers to press the plungers down in their chambers. This, in turn, compresses, squeezes, and extrudes sealant between the mounting bracket and the roof below forming a water tight seal.
